Convallaria majalis 'Bordeaux'
Giant lily of the valley
Convallaria Convallaria
'Bordeaux' _ 'Bordeaux' is a deciduous perennial with nodding, bell-shaped, fragrant white flowers and paired, elliptic leaves. Nearly double the size of a traditional Lily of the Valley.

Convallaria majalis 'Bordeaux' (Giant lily of the valley) will reach a height of 0.3m and a spread of 0.5m after 2-5 years.
Cottage/Informal, Ground Cover, Low Maintenance, Underplanting
Plant in fertile, humus-rich moist soil in full or part shade. Mulch with leaf mould in autumn.
